We are developing the frequency-domain multiplexing (FDM) readout for the SAFARI far-infrared spectrometer on board the SPICA space observatory. Each readout channel comprises a set of similar to 160 TESs and LC filters and is read out with a SQUID preamplifier. Baseband feedback is applied to overcome the dynamic range limitations of the SQUID. We have carried out extensive characterization of a test readout system coupled to a 176-pixel TES bolometer array in order to understand and optimize the system. We present our latest measurements of this 176-pixel FDM demonstrator, focusing on the noise contribution from the SQUID.
